>rogue gallery
Editorial has repeatedly killed them off, spun them over to other properties, or retconned them into irrelevance
Up till the 80s, his rogues were Batman's rogues.
Deathstroke - Rolled over to Green Arrow, New 52'd. Shit, now he's more of a Batman villain. Fuck you DC.
Brother Blood - Killed by Johns for his Teen Blood character
Mr Twister/Gargoyle - Forgotten and New 52'd
Blockbuster - Killed by Grayson, reset to the original in New 52.
Tarantula - New 52'd, rolled over to Green Arrow
Shrike - Ruined by Kelley Puckett
Professor Pyg - Rolled up to Batman
Red Hood - New 52'd, now an anti-hero
James Gordon Jr. - Ruined by Gail Simone
Owlman - Johns dropped the ball on this, never followed up, and killed him instead.
Luka Netz - She's still out there, along with whatever's left of Dedalus' Spyral
Parliament of Owls/Raptor - Too early to tell how this'll go

Then he still has his own personal relationships with the standard bat-rogues. But if DC could just fix a couple of the big villains on this list, I would be soooooo happy.

Dick is an overachieving B lister who is too similar to Batman on his own, and DC/WB cares more about Justice League than Teen Titans and always has (minus the early 80s and the beginning of Johns' run).

They're just fine with putting writers who haven't proven themselves on his book (and TT), and if all goes well, they get moved to something different, because Dick (and TT) sells just fine when they're mediocre.
Grayson was fantastic yet it didn't sell much better than Nightwing solos before, so they put the better writer on a bigger title people care about (i.e. Batman).

And since he hasn't had a "defining" run, writers who come in start over to make their own defining run. Sometimes crossovers ruin their plans (Grayson the writer and Higgins), and sometimes editorial just fucks you over completely (Grayson the writer and King/Seeley).

Again, mostly because DC doesn't care about him and doesn't HAVE to care about him.
